President-elect Joseph R. Biden Jr. announced on Friday that he will
elevate the role of science in his cabinet as part of an effort to
“refresh and reinvigorate our national science and technology strategy.”

Mr. Biden will nominate Eric S. Lander, the director of the Broad
Institute of M.I.T. and Harvard, to serve as director of the Office of
Science and Technology Policy, and also appoint him to serve as
presidential science adviser. For the first time, the position will be
elevated to the cabinet level.

The appointments signal a drastic switch from the role of science in the
Trump administration. President Trump left the position of science
adviser empty for 18 months, while his administration routinely ignored
the guidance of government scientists on issues including the
coronavirus pandemic, chemical pollution and climate change.
